<strong>Pinnacle</strong> Point 7 (cont.)<br />

9. OKDHS will finalize agency protocols for engaging and coordinating services for victims <strong>of</strong><br />

domestic violence and share these protocols with partner agencies including law<br />

enforcement, domestic violence service providers, and other mental health agencies as<br />

appropriate.<br />

10. OKDHS will request and support the Court Improvement Program by conducting a pilot in<br />

one to three counties to expand mediation so that it occurs earlier in the process <strong>of</strong> court<br />

involvement.<br />

11. OKDHS will explore the possibility <strong>of</strong> responding to the screened-out Hotline referrals by<br />

<strong>of</strong>fering community services to those families.<br />

12. OKDHS will collaborate with <strong>Oklahoma</strong> Schools <strong>of</strong> Social Work to increase the number <strong>of</strong><br />

social work students interested in applying for positions with OKDHS.<br />

13. OKDHS will collaborate with the Youth Services Agencies in creating a statewide vision or plan<br />

to identify ways they can better serve families involved in child welfare as they shift their<br />

business model away from shelter usage to more comprehensive services.<br />

14. In collaboration with the <strong>Oklahoma</strong> <strong>Department</strong> <strong>of</strong> Mental Health and Substance Abuse<br />

Services (ODMHSAS), OKDHS will increase the number <strong>of</strong> children involved in child welfare<br />

services who are also served through Systems <strong>of</strong> Care. <strong>The</strong> work will begin in Year One, and<br />

will require at least five years to fully implement.<br />
